Transaction 5111a361c559274ebed3f11a7d998cfe0c23a20fe518e46c2a494bdcd79e73c3
1 Input
1 Output
-
5111a361c559274ebed3f11a7d998cfe0c23a20fe518e46c2a494bdcd79e73c3:0
- value
- 273156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e75df346334434c0402fa65a2f581ac8fcddfca OP_EQUAL
- address
- 38qsqPXepYbyYJJucZqVCCKERJLV8keeSk